Filters:
clear
Country: United Kingdom

led light panels in Liverpool

About 2 results.

iSOL Power LTD

Keel Wharf, L3 4EX Liverpool, United Kingdom

Solar PV systems- Solar panels - Solar street lights- Solar mobile generators and light towers solar photovoltaic off grid systems solar grid tied systems solar generators pv grid tied systems pv…

NES Roofing and Energy

thumb_up 151 likes
rate_review 3 Reviews
17 Mann Island, Liverpool Waterfront,, L3 1BP Liverpool, United Kingdom

We offer a wide range of high quality Solar PV, Roofing and Energy related products and services. Call us on 0151 632 3027 to learn more.

  • 1